Forest Holme Hospice has revealed that the Dolphin Shopping Centre in Poole will be the location of its new vintage-style charity shop.

Set to open on Saturday October 20, The Secret Wardrobe will sell pre-loved vintage clothes, art deco jewellery and shabby-chic furniture. All the proceeds from the store will go to the Poole hospice, which cares for patients with cancer and other life-limiting illnesses.

Diane Platt, charity manager at Forest Holme Hospice, says: “We would like to thank the team at the Dolphin Shopping Centre for their help to realise our plans for a Forest Holme retail outlet. “We are very excited to be starting work on our new shop and are looking forward to filling it with all the fine vintage pieces that we have received from generous members of the public.”

The Big Yellow Self Storage Company on Nuffield Road is still accepting donations of vintage items on behalf of Forest Holme Hospice. Free parking is available for visitors who would like to drop off their donations during the opening hours of 8am-6pm Monday- Friday, 9am-6pm Saturday and 10am-4pm Sunday.

John Grinnell, centre manager of the Dolphin Shopping Centre said: “As our chosen charity of the year, we are delighted to be able to offer our support to Forest Holme Hospice. We feel The Secret Wardrobe has the potential to become quite the destination store for the centre.”
